Can You Change Seats After Check-In? ✈️ Seat Change Tips

Many travelers wonder whether it is possible to change seats after check in at the airport. Understanding how seat selection works after you have checked in can help you manage expectations and reduce stress before boarding.

This guide explains the conditions under which seat changes are allowed, the role of your ticket type, and how airline policies and airport procedures may affect your options.

Online Check In Seat Options

During online check in, most airlines display a seat map that shows current availability. If your ticket type includes free seat selection, you can usually choose or change seats up to a few hours before departure. Seats may be reassigned automatically if the flight is heavily booked, so it is best to confirm your selection before leaving for the airport.

Airport Check In Procedures

At the airport, seat assignment depends on the kiosk or counter agent. Some low fare tickets restrict changes unless you pay a fare difference or upgrade. If you are in the same booking class and seats are still open, an agent may move you to a preferred location. Boarding passes issued at the counter generally reflect the final seat assignment.

Group and Special Assistance Requests

For families, colleagues, or passengers needing additional support, seat changes after check in are often handled as a special request. Airlines typically try to keep groups together if adjacent seats exist. Submitting this request during check in gives staff more time to adjust seating before the aircraft is full.

Boarding Process and Last Minute Changes

As boarding begins, the number of changeable seats usually decreases. If the flight is not full, gate agents may still move passengers to open seats, especially when optimizing load balance. Once boarding is complete or the doors are closing, seat changes become very difficult or impossible without exceptional circumstances.

FAQ

Reader questions

Can I change seats at the gate if the flight is almost full?

Gate agents may still accommodate seat requests if there are open seats and no operational constraints, but options are limited late in the boarding process.

Will changing seats affect my checked baggage or boarding time?

Seat changes typically do not affect checked baggage, but they should be completed before final boarding is called to avoid delays.

Do premium tickets guarantee seat changes after check in?

Premium tickets often include more flexibility, but final seat availability depends on airline policy and aircraft configuration at the time of request.

What happens if I request a seat change after boarding has started?

In most cases, seat changes are not permitted after boarding has started, except for pre-approved exceptions such as medical needs.
